WebThe orchid flower has the feminine and masculine organ of reproduction fusing in only one body called a column or gynostemium. The flower has an irregular form. It has three sepals and three petals. The medium petal is modified and is called labellum or lip. WebJan 13, 2009 · ORCHID FLOWERS: ‘ENDLESS FORMS MOST BEAUTIFUL’ BY ‘VARIATION ON A SCHEME’ The typical flower of a petaloid monocot consists of five fundamentally 3-fold whorls or derivatives thereof. However, in contrast with other petaloid monocots, such as lilies or tulips, orchids have flowers of breathtaking morphological diversity (Fig. 1 A). WebMar 1, 2024 · Remove all the growing medium from the root mass, and then cut away any long dangling or dead roots. Put the plant in a pot close to the size of its root mass, and cover the roots with orchid potting medium.
